Which of the following is NOT a prime number? A. 3163 B. 1057 C. 157 D. 263

Hello : 
B) 1057 <span>is NOT a prime number because : 1057 = 7×151
( 4 divisors ; 1 , 1057 , 151 , 7)</span>
